Similarities Modern /Ancient How often? Athletes? Motto Events Every four years Both allow men to take part Swifter, Higher and Stronger Have horse riding and running races. Compete for? Honour

Differences Ancient Olympics Modern Olympics Sets (kinds) only Olympic both and Olympics Athletes   Prizes Country Events House Summer Summer Winter Only men, no women and slaves Both men and women Olive wreath Olympic medals Only Greece All the countries More than 250 sports A special village
